Here is how you tell your speakers are screwed up.
Get an ohm meter (or a DMM) and then put the leads together and you should read .004 or something like that, very small, that is what the leads resistance is. After that place the leads at the end of your speaker wire (or terminals, or the speaker itself) if you read nothing, oL or it flashes your speakers are confirmed DEAD, if you read 4, 8, 16 something like that your speakers are probally good. DMM's can cost like 6 bucks at like autozone or something.
Also you can put a fues inline with one wire of the speaker (perferably the (+)) so that the fues blows instead of your speakers, and also put a resistor across the terminals of your speaker (4 ohm)
